National Juvenile Taekwon-Do Championship Opens in DPRK

Pyongyang, August 21 (KCNA) -- The National Juvenile Taekwon-Do Championship opened in the DPRK on Aug. 20.

Taking part in the championship, to be held at the Taekwon-Do Hall and the Taekwon-Do Holy House, are more than 550 players and coaches from various units, including the Ryongaksan Taekwon-Do Team, the young Taekwon-Do players training school of the Pyongyang Municipal Taekwon-Do Team, and Korea University of Physical Education.

Competition will be made in Taekwon-Do (pattern, sparring, special technique and self-defense) and Paduk events.

That day there were men's and women's Taekwon-Do individual and team pattern competitions and men's and women's Paduk individual matches. -0-
